Synopsis "An Upward Draft: (Book Two of the FugueTrilogy)"

Running from the fallout of the incident that uprooted him from his mundane family life in suburban California, Richard Keiffer finds himself on a South American wine estate where he has no choice but to accept a cryptic bargain extended to him by its maturely flamboyant owner, Madame. Under her baton, he undergoes an intense and disruptive mental, emotional, and physical reeducation designed to turn him into a member of a covert organization, whose guiding principle is that "much good can be achieved with a dash of evil." Only days after being dispatched on his first assignment in southwest France, Richard's reconstructed self is tested well beyond the scope of Madame's plans as he is drawn into an unsettling global health scare. An Upward Draft follows the hero of A Feeble Drift on the second stage of his transformative journey but is written as a stand-alone novel.
